Output edddb91f322a8ec04bb5e202bbd88b88d752c209bd9a1b8c0962082f18bb2d73:1

value
612903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ee5f93d463ab5c7330731d3c5e310c7cbdff9e17 OP_EQUAL
address
3PRRF396PzRVZxxKwtBR6Nj5wpUAnMy7W7
transaction
edddb91f322a8ec04bb5e202bbd88b88d752c209bd9a1b8c0962082f18bb2d73
confirmations
3099
spent
true